Unlocking Agility and Scalability in Metro Networks with SDM

Metro networks face unique challenges in terms of agility and scalability. Demand patterns are often dynamic and unpredictable, requiring networks to adapt quickly to changing needs. Traditional network architectures can struggle to keep pace with these demands, leading to performance bottlenecks and service disruptions. Software-Defined Metro (SDM) emerges as a transformative solution, enabling metro networks to realize unprecedented agility and scalability.

With SDM, control of the network is centralized in a software layer, allowing for flexible management and orchestration. This empowers operators to deploy resources on demand, tune network performance in real-time, and address changing conditions with celerity. The inherent elasticity of SDM allows metro networks to expand seamlessly, accommodating fluctuating traffic demands without compromising performance.

  • SDM enables intelligent network operations, reducing manual intervention and freeing up valuable resources.
  • Leveraging SDN controllers, operators can monitor the entire network landscape, gaining deeper knowledge into performance trends and potential issues.
  • SDM facilitates seamless orchestration across diverse network domains, including access, enabling a truly cohesive and efficient metro network infrastructure.

Software-Defined Metro Networking: Delivering Seamless Network Experiences

Software-Defined Metro Networking (SDMN) is modernizing the way we deploy metro networks. By harnessing software to orchestrate network resources, SDMN facilitates service providers to offer seamless and resilient network experiences. This approach allows for dynamic provisioning of services, streamlined resource allocation, and boosted overall network QoS. SDMN furthermore supports the implementation of innovative technologies such as virtualization, cloud computing, and edge automation.

  • Advantages of SDMN include:
  • Increased network agility and responsiveness
  • Lowered operational costs through automation
  • Improved service reliability
  • Flexible resource allocation to meet evolving demands

As the demands on metro networks escalate, SDMN will take a pivotal role in delivering high-performance connectivity for businesses and users.
